I wanted a small tray/holder where I could put my Lume Rip Pods* on my dresser. It's simple, but thought I'd share. It may be over-engineered, but it's my first designed Thing, and I'm pretty new to doing parametrics but if anyone wants to take this to the next level so you can make any size tray you need, let me know in comments and I'll share the AutoDesk Fusion file.

For me, 3 works well. In case there's any sort of rosin that escapes, the pod doesn't sit flush to the bottom of the hole.

I went with 15% infill, you could do 10% if like to live dangerously.

* Lume is a chain of cannabis dispensaries in Michigan (and perhaps in other US states that have legalized it). I do not work for them, nor do I sell their products. I just use their Rip Pods.
